How did henry ford cause a major shift in americans' living patterns in the early 1900s??

2 Answers

5 votes
he revolutionized the assembly line and made it better, making it self moving. this made work easier and cheaper to do, which got him rich, and he paid his workers a lot more than what most businesses would at that time.
